Got The Look 
By James Grippando
A lawyer's new girlfriend is kidnapped. He didn’t know she was married and her husband refuses to pay. How much is she worth to him? Lots of twists right up to the surprising end.

~Karen S.

Elevation 
By Stephen King
King's writing is filled with optimism, sadness, and a search for answers to life's most unanswerable questions. A riveting book that I thoroughly enjoyed cover-to-cover.

~Valdajean J.





Save Me The Plums: My Gourmet Memoir 
By Ruth Reichl 
A book about the author’s ten years running Gourmet magazine. Reichs tells a great story. One of her best books. So well written and it made me really hungry. I want to make all of the dishes listed in the accompanying recipes!

~Tricia L.
